dynamic form creation.

I need to build a aspx page that collects data.
On the page I have a dropdown for the number of people attending the event.
I want a dynamic  form that requests attendees information, but only for the number of attendees.
This has to live in the .net world
Who is Participating?
I wear a lot of hats...

"The solutions and answers provided on Experts Exchange have been extremely helpful to me over the last few years. I wear a lot of hats - Developer, Database Administrator, Help Desk, etc., so I know a lot of things but not a lot about one thing. Experts Exchange gives me answers from people who do know a lot about one thing, in a easy to use platform." -Todd S.

ste5anSenior DeveloperCommented:
What architecture did you choose? .aspx and .Net can mean a bunch of different approaches. Here you should look at https://asp.net for further information, documentation and lots of videos.

What does dynamic mean by your terms? Based on what requirements or data? The approach nowadays would be doing it in the client. Otherwise it can be a grid component or anything else..
bcrooksAuthor Commented:
It is built within our Ektron CMS, all of our pages are aspx pages targeting .NET framework 4.6.1.
Our CMS do not have this capability so we need to build it outside - we understand the database storing and do not need help with that part.

I wish to create a page that collects user information, so if the user chooses to invite 3 other invitees it will create three textboxes, If the user  chooses to invite 25 other invitees it will create 25 textboxes.  

you mention a grid component - I would need help understanding and building that.
It's more than this solution.Get answers and train to solve all your tech problems - anytime, anywhere.Try it for free Edge Out The Competitionfor your dream job with proven skills and certifications.Get started today Stand Outas the employee with proven skills.Start learning today for free Move Your Career Forwardwith certification training in the latest technologies.Start your trial today
Web Development

From novice to tech pro — start learning today.